Helldras are first encountered on 12F in Etrian Odyssey II: Heroes of Lagaard. They can also be summoned by Snowsouls, which are found throughout the 3rd Stratum, starting from 11F. As FOEs, Helldra are passive and do not move during the day. Once it is night, they begin patrolling like any other FOE. Helldra have no elemental weakness and are somewhat resilient to magic attacks.
